First, let's talk about what makes our search special. Our Iowa climate means your dog's retreat needs to handle everything from humid summer days to crisp, cold winters. A great local option will have climate-controlled indoor spaces for play and rest, plus secure outdoor areas for those beloved sniff-and-explore sessions. When you're evaluating a facility, ask about their protocol for our active seasons—like ensuring dogs are wiped down after playing in spring mud or have warm, dry bedding during a January cold snap. A place that understands our weather is a place that truly cares.

The key is to plan ahead, especially during peak times like the Fourth of July or the Clayton County Fair. Start your search early and schedule a tour. Seeing the space, meeting the staff, and observing how they interact with their guests will give you way more peace of mind than any website.
Here’s a practical tip: use your local network! Ask your vet at Tri-County Veterinary Clinic for recommendations, or chat with fellow dog owners at the Randalia ball diamond. Personal referrals are gold. When you call a potential spot, ask specific questions: What’s their routine? Can you bring your dog’s own food (to avoid any tummy troubles)? How do they handle a pup that might miss the quiet of our country roads? The right place will welcome your questions.
